Overview
- Juventus confirmed Luciano Spalletti as head coach on a contract through June 30, 2026, announcing after market close and scheduling his presentation for midday Friday.
- Spalletti began work at the Continassa with medical checks, a facilities tour and initial player meetings, including a club video where he told Mattia Perin, "It will depend on you."
- Reporting indicates he will keep changes minimal for the trip to Cremona, with a 3-4-2-1 or 3-5-2 shape viewed as the likely starting point before broader tactical shifts.
- Coverage details a cultural reset under Spalletti with stricter rules on phones at meals and meetings, zero tolerance for lateness and limits on headphones and PlayStation use.
- Media outline a staff featuring Marco Domenichini, Giovanni Martusciello, Salvatore Russo and fitness coach Francesco Sinatti, plus a reported salary near €3 million with renewal incentives tied to Champions League qualification.
